Frozen shoulder (also known as adhesive capsulitis) is a painful condition that affects the shoulder joint. This is a painful condition in which the movement of the shoulder becomes limited. Normally, the soft tissue surrounding the shoulder joint (capsule) is usually stretchy and elastic allowing joint mobility. Frozen shoulder occurs when the capsule around the shoulder joint becomes thickened and inflamed, causing pain, stiffness and reduced range of motion. This painful stiffening over time leads to sleep disturbance and limits ability to use arm in day-to-day activities.
Kinesiophobia (fear of movement) defined as "an excessive, irrational, and debilitating fear of physical movement and activity resulting from a feeling of vulnerability due to painful injury or reinjury" is an important psychological factor in musculoskeletal disorders. Kinesiophobia has been implicated in the transition from acute to chronic pain and in the persistence of pain-related disability even after tissue healing.
The goal of this observational study is to investigate the relationship between kinesiophobia and pain, range of motion, disability, and quality of life in patients with adhesive capsulitis.Participants in the study will only undergo a physical examination and complete some questionnaires; no invasive procedures will be performed.
详细描述
Adhesive capsulitis is a common shoulder disorder characterized by pain and progressive restriction of both active and passive range of motion, leading to substantial limitations in activities of daily living, occupational performance, and leisure activities. It most frequently affects middle-aged individuals and is more prevalent in women.
Clinically, patients with adhesive capsulitis present with shoulder pain and progressive stiffness. Functional limitations typically include difficulty performing overhead activities and tasks requiring hand-behind-the-back movements, which significantly impair quality of life. Although restriction occurs in all planes of shoulder motion, passive external rotation is generally the most limited, followed by abduction and internal rotation.
The exact etiopathogenesis of adhesive capsulitis remains unclear; however, it is widely accepted that the pathological process primarily involves the joint capsule, particularly the coracohumeral ligament and the anterior-superior capsule. Chronic inflammation, possibly triggered by autoimmune mechanisms, infectious agents, or biochemical mediators, is thought to initiate the process. Subsequent fibroblastic proliferation, collagen deposition, capsular thickening, fibrosis, and adhesion formation lead to restricted joint mobility. In addition to these biological mechanisms, psychological factors have also been suggested to contribute to the development and persistence of adhesive capsulitis.
Kinesiophobia, defined as an excessive, irrational, and debilitating fear of movement due to the expectation of pain or re-injury, is an important psychological factor in musculoskeletal disorders. It is commonly associated with avoidance behaviors and hypervigilance. Kinesiophobia has been implicated in the transition from acute to chronic pain and in the persistence of pain-related disability even after tissue healing. Consequently, higher levels of kinesiophobia have been associated with increased pain intensity, greater disability, reduced range of motion, and poorer quality of life in individuals with chronic musculoskeletal conditions.
Although the relationship between kinesiophobia and clinical outcomes has been extensively studied in various musculoskeletal disorders, evidence in shoulder pathologies remains limited. Previous studies have reported significant associations between kinesiophobia and pain, disability, and functional limitations. For example, Mintken et al. demonstrated a strong relationship between elevated kinesiophobia levels and increased pain and disability. Similarly, Luque-Suarez et al. reported that higher kinesiophobia levels were associated with greater pain intensity and disability. Another study involving 85 patients found that increased kinesiophobia was linked to poorer upper extremity function and higher pain levels.

入选标准
- •Age between 18 and 65 years
- •Clinical diagnosis of adhesive capsulitis according to Vermeulen criteria, defined as ≥50% loss of passive range of motion in at least one of the following planes compared to the contralateral side: abduction, flexion, or external rotation in abduction
- •Ability to understand and complete questionnaires
排除标准
- •Presence of other orthopedic, rheumatologic, neurological, or malignant conditions affecting the shoulder
- •History of shoulder trauma, fracture, dislocation, or surgery
- •Full-thickness rotator cuff tear (e.g., positive drop arm test, significant weakness)
- •Cervical radiculopathy or thoracic outlet syndrome
- •Receipt of intra-articular injection, physical therapy, or other shoulder treatments within the previous 6 months
- •Cognitive impairment or psychiatric/neurological disorders affecting comprehension
